Toward Greener Hybrid Composites: Effect of Wood Powder and Calcium Carbonate on Recycled HDPE With Tyre and MAPE Modifiers

open access: yesSPE Polymers, Volume 7, Issue 2, April 2026.
Recycled high‐density polyethylene (rHDPE) was reinforced with wood powder (0–25 wt%) and calcium carbonate (5 wt%), modified with ground tyre powder (5 wt%) and maleic anhydride grafted polypropylene (MAPP, 5 wt%). The hybrid filler system demonstrated: Mechanical Enhancement: Tensile strength increased by 25.5%, stiffness by 45%, and tensile modulus ...
